## Releases — Offline Mode

Marrowfield 2.3 ships offline-first. Survey forms queue in local storage and sync when connectivity returns; conflict resolution is last-write-wins per field. Do not bump the schema version mid-cycle — offline clients may lag by weeks. Release bundles must be built with `--offline-assets` or map tiles won't embed. Every bundle pushed to field devices is signed; devices reject unsigned updates. Sign releases with the key below.

release key, kahif-yagap: bky3_1JN

Ticket: Staging env misconfigured for Siftgate bloom filter

The bloom layer in front of the Pellet KV store is rejecting all lookups in staging because the env file was copied from the dev template without credentials. False-positive tuning values are fine; only the auth line is missing. To unblock the weekly demo, the Pellet admission secret must be set on the following line.

env line for yaguf-fajop: LEDGER_TOKEN13=fb08984397349

Capacity note — Hallwrender audio-guide, v3.2 release.

Peak load is driven by the Velmora Museum's Saturday openings: bursts of simultaneous tour-pack downloads plus streamed narration. Current fleet handles projected peak with ~30% headroom if prefetch stays capped and stream bitrate adapts down under pressure. Do not ship with prefetch uncapped; last soak test showed CDN egress doubling. All tuning is centralized in one config block so the release can be rolled back without a code change. Ship with the following values.

constants for tageg-kagag:
QUOTAS = {
    "kelax": 495,
    "istath": 366,
    "tammir": 108,
    "novdor": 730,
    "casax": 816,
    "quenael": 874,
    "pelius": 403,
}

Forward cover currently stands at 40% of projected receipts; we propose raising this to 70% over the next two quarters, using staggered contracts to avoid concentration at a single settlement date. Estimated cost of carry is modest relative to the downside scenario modelled by Finance. Chief Treasurer Ilse Brannock will present full sensitivities at the October session. The strategic rationale is set out in the confidential note below.

confidential, fahip-bagep: The southern region missed its Holwyn quota by 21.5 percent last quarter. Sorvanek Foods plans to raise the Jorir list price by 23.9 percent in December. The pricing group signed off on a budget of $411.6 million for Project Eliion. The renewal with Juldorix Works closes at $87.9 million a year, 16.8 percent below the last contract.